要在阿里云服务器上安装和配置MySQL数据库,请按照以下步骤操作:,1. 在阿里云控制台中创建一个RDS MySQL实例,并获取连接地址。,2. 在阿里云控制台上下载并安装MySQL客户端。,3. 连接到新创建的MySQL实例,使用命令:, ``, mysql -u root -p,
`,4. 创建一个新的数据库,,
`, CREATE DATABASE test;,
`,5. 创建一个新的用户账号,,
`, GRANT ALL PRIVILEGES ON test.* TO 'test'@'%';, FLUSH PRIVILEGES;,
``,6. 完成以上步骤后,您可以在本地通过SQL工具访问您的MySQL数据库。
在云计算时代,无论是个人开发者、企业开发团队还是大型互联网公司,都需要依赖数据库来存储和管理大量数据,对于大多数用户来说,选择合适的数据库服务是一个重要的决定,今天我们将重点介绍如何在阿里云的云服务器(ECS)上安装并配置MySQL数据库。
你需要一个阿里云账户,如果你还没有阿里云账号,可以通过阿里云官网免费创建一个,完成注册后,使用你的账号登录阿里云控制台。
根据你对性能的需求,选择合适的实例类型,对于日常使用的开发环境,可以选择以下实例:
在控制台上找到“实例”选项卡,选择相应的实例类型,并点击“购买”按钮开始购买流程。
按照系统提示进行操作,确认支付方式后即可购买并启动新的云服务器实例,购买完成后,你会收到一个动态IP地址,这是新实例的对外访问入口。
为了方便管理和监控,建议为该实例绑定公网IP(如动态IP),一旦绑定了公网IP,就可以通过浏览器直接访问了。
打开命令行工具,输入ping <公网IP>
检查网络连接是否正常,如果一切顺利,你应该能看到一条回复信息,表示网络连接成功。
现在我们已经准备好了一台运行中的云服务器,我们需要安装MySQL数据库,在阿里云控制台中,导航至“我的服务器”,找到刚刚购买的实例ID,点击进入。
在实例详情页面中,找到“操作系统版本”下的“软件包列表”,如果没有安装MySQL,请查看是否有相应的信息,如果有,你可以从这里复制相关命令进行安装。
MySQL的默认安装路径是在 /usr/local/mysql/
下,安装过程中可能需要一些依赖库,可以参考官方文档或者在线资源获取。
MySQL安装完毕后,需要进行一些基本的配置工作以确保安全性和稳定性,具体步骤如下:
更改root用户的密码:
mysql -u root -e "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password'; FLUSH PRIVILEGES;"
启用远程访问:
编辑 my.cnf
配置文件,添加或修改如下配置:
[mysqld] bind-address = 0.0.0.0
这将允许MySQL监听所有接口。
重启MySQL服务:
service mysqld restart 或者 sudo systemctl restart mysql
设置MySQL管理员用户名和密码: 打开MySQL终端,使用新创建的管理员账户和密码登录:
mysql -uroot -p
创建数据库和用户: 使用新创建的管理员账户执行SQL命令创建数据库和用户:
CREATE DATABASE mydatabase; GRANT ALL ON mydatabase.* TO 'username'@'%' IDENTIFIED BY 'password'; FLUSH PRIVILEGES;
关闭MySQL服务(可选): 如果暂时不需要使用MySQL服务,可以将其停止并禁用开机自启:
service mysqld stop chkconfig --level 35 mysqld off
通过浏览器访问云服务器的外网IP地址,然后输入MySQL端口号(默认3306),输入之前创建的管理员用户名和密码,即可登录MySQL。
通过以上步骤,你已经在阿里云的云服务器上成功安装和配置了MySQL数据库,这对于任何希望在云环境中部署和管理数据库的应用都非常实用。
虚拟主机推荐 :美国虚拟主机 香港虚拟主机 俄罗斯虚拟主机热卖推荐 上云必备低价长效云服务器99元/1年,OSS 低至 118.99 元/1年,官方优选推荐
热卖推荐 香港、美国、韩国、日本、限时优惠 立刻购买